Forum: GUI-Design mit VCL / FireMonkey / Common Controls
Delphi
by Sir Rufo,
3. Feb 2014
Bei deiner Variante wird der MainThread aber blockiert
LForm.Show;
// Wir befinden uns im MainThread-Context und da tut sich jetzt nichts mehr, bis der Thread abgearbeitet ist
LThread.WaitFor;
und das ist bei meiner Variante eben genau nicht der Fall.
Forum: GUI-Design mit VCL / FireMonkey / Common Controls
Delphi
by Sir Rufo,
3. Feb 2014
Mal so ein kleiner Minimalcode:
var
LForm : TForm;
LThread : TThread;
begin
LForm := TSplashScreen.Create( nil );
try
LThread := TStartupThread.Create( LForm );
Forum: GUI-Design mit VCL / FireMonkey / Common Controls
Delphi
by Sir Rufo,
3. Feb 2014
Es riecht hier nach Splash-Screen :)